“S” marks the Spot!: An afternoon of piano with Jeanne Golan


Schubert, Schulhof and Shostakovich will be sounding out for DOROT Artist/Scholar in Residence Jeanne Golan’s season opener! Golan will be joined by special guest artist Judith Ablon for the Shostakovich Viola Sonata, a piece that quotes Beethoven’s Moonlight Sonata. Also on the program is the Schubert Piano Sonata In A Major, D644, with Schulhoff’s Chanson sandwiched in-between.


DOROT is a non-profit social service agency that provides life-enhancing programs and services for adults 60 and older to help them live independently as valued members of the community.
